NAME Cache::NullCache -- implements the Cache interface. DESCRIPTION The NullCache class implements the Cache::Cache interface, but does not actually persist data. This is useful when developing and debugging a system and you wish to easily turn off caching. As a result, all calls to get and get_object will return undef. SYNOPSIS use Cache::NullCache; my $cache = new Cache::NullCache( ); See Cache::Cache for the usage synopsis. METHODS See Cache::Cache for the API documentation.
